Smart grill maker Traeger has bought wireless meat thermometer company Meater, which it says marks the next step in creating the “ultimate connected grilling experience.” Traeger allows users to monitor and control connected grills through a smartphone or Apple Watch.
Correspondingly, how accurate is Traeger thermometer?
The Traeger thermometer is capable of measuring temperatures ranging from -58 to 572 degrees Fahrenheit, accurate within one percent of the displayed reading so you can be sure meats reach recommended internal temperatures for safe consumption.

Hereof, what thermometer do pitmasters use?
ThermoWorks makes the thermometers that pro pitmasters and barbeque chefs use the most. It’s as simple as that. Ask a few pro pitmasters what their most-prized grilling possessions are and, after the pit itself, a well-calibrated thermometer will be high on the list.
Which is better ThermoWorks or ThermoPro?
Thermoworks Smoke vs ThermoPro TP-20 Thermometer
Smoke thermometer is a bit easier to program, much more reliable and has few more features. … The ThermoPro TP-20 has a clearer display hence,reading it is much easier.
